DocumentCode :
187327
Title :
A Formal Method Applied to the Automated Software Engineering with Quality Guarantees
Author :
Teixeira, Marcelo ; Ribeiro, Richardson ; Barbosa, Marco ; Marin, Luis
Author_Institution :
Univ. Tecnol. Fed. do Parana (UTFPR), Pato Branco, Brazil
fYear :
2014
fDate :
3-6 Nov. 2014
Firstpage :
108
Lastpage :
111
Abstract :
Modern systems tend to be larger, more complex and to depend on an increasingly numerous set of requirements. In contrast, system development practices remain human-centered, depending mostly on the engineer expertise to be carried out. This paper shows how maximally permissive and deadlock-free components of software can be automatically produced. We argue that modeling methods and mathematical operations can be combined to systematically manage the software development process, based on high-level views of the system. Results show that possibly complex programming tasks become easier and independent from the expertise of the software engineer. Examples are provided to illustrate the approach.
Keywords :
formal specification; software development management; software quality; automated software engineering; formal method; software deadlock-free components; software development process; software quality guarantees; Mathematical model; Modeling; Programming; Software; Software engineering; Software reliability; Transmitters;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Software Reliability Engineering Workshops (ISSREW), 2014 IEEE International Symposium on
Conference_Location :
Naples
Type :
conf
DOI :
10.1109/ISSREW.2014.43
Filename :
6983813
Link To Document :
بازگشت